Kirk Herbstreit is back to his usual routine. The former Ohio State standout and College GameDay analyst listed his top individual performances from a strong Week 1 late Tuesday night.

Herbstreit liked what he saw from a pair of B1G standouts: Penn State’s Drew Allar and Minnesota’s Tyler Nubin.

Here’s the rest of his list, including Jordan Travis, Kaimon Rucker and Colorado’s trio of dynamic playmakers, among others.

Let’s start with Allar, who’s hype has been through the roof heading into the 2023 season. And he delivered Saturday night against West Virginia. The sophomore QB threw for 325 yards and 3 touchdowns in the Nittany Lions’ 38-15 win over the Mountaineers.

Nubin had a strong showing as well. The Minnesota DB picked off Nebraska QB Jeff Sims twice on Thursday, including the INT that led to Minnesota’s game-winning field goal.
